getting current screen orientation in android

The following snippet gives the current screen orientation.

public int getScreenOrientation()
{
        return getResources().getConfiguration().orientation;
}

The above method return integer. We will compare as follows.

 if(getScreenOrientation() == Configuration.ORIENTATION_PORTRAIT)
 {
            //App is in Portrait mode
 }
 else
{
           //App is in LandScape mode
}
